BBC iPlayer

I would welcome advice on the possibility of sending TV programmes such as the BBC iplayer to a TV somewhere else in the House. Along with the equipment required.

    You would need to have a PC or Laptop that can output video composite / RGB signals. If you've got that, then use a video cable (or video sender / receiver) to watch on a TV.

    But that would produce no sound from the TV remember.

    It is very difficult to do what the OP wants. Also what is iplayer quality like on a screen of 28" or larger? I would guess not that good but still watchable?
  • Sorry to jump on this one but can you record the downloaded program to a DVD and if so using what system?

    I just burned the programme I downloaded to a disc and then 'made it compatible' such that it should play on any dvd player but it wont play on th dvd player.

    Any advise?

  • Family - you can't burn them to DVD - they have DRM (digital rights management) which restricts their use. I've tried removing it, but the quality is effected.
